TALKBOX SYNTH offers classic and new sounds to the guitarist's arsenal. From instantly recognizable talkbox "hose-in-the-mouth" sounds to wonderfully electronic "talking robot" effects, imagine yourself commanding attention at jams and gigs. Even when the effect is off, TALKBOX SYNTH can vastly improve your core vocal sound with Adaptive Tone, reverb and pitch correction.

Classic talkbox effects have always come through a PA, not a guitar amp, so TALKBOX SYNTH is the ideal way to bridge that gap. The XLR output of TALKBOX SYNTH sends your polished vocal mic output to the PA while also outputting the on-board effects when you hit the foot switch. The guitar input and output circuitry is designed to preserve your precious guitar tone as it passes to your pedals and amplifier.

GUITAR TO SYNTH TRANSFORMED

The on-board synthesizer is triggered by your single note guitar playing and can translate your solos and licks into something even a skilled keyboardist would marvel at. The nuances of finger vibrato combined with your vocal expression take your guitar solos and licks from earthbound to mile high in an instant.

YOUR PERSONAL SOUND TECH

Adaptive EQ (equalization), compression, de-ess, and gate automatically control the timbre and shape of your vocal, ensuring that every note you sing is clean and clear. Because when the crowd can hear what you're singing, they can sing along and there is nothing is better than that!

With transparent auto-chromatic pitch correction, Talkbox Synth nudges your pitch to the nearest semitone. It won't turn a potato into a spaceship, but it can give you a little support when you need it most.

STUDIO GRADE REVERB

Reverb simulates a physical space, allowing your voice to fit into the music perfectly. Whether its the ambiance of a small room, or the massive reverberation of a concert hall, TalkBox Synth's vocally tuned reverb always brings out the best in your voice.

SPECS:

Effects

- Guitar Talk Box and Vocoder

- Synth Vocoder

- Reverb

- Pitch Correction

- Adaptive Tone

Control

- Guitar Talk Box and Vocoder effects with or without guitar thru

- Selection of 4 Synth Vocoder waveforms

- Correction amount 0 to 100%

- 3 vocally tuned Reverb styles with adjustable level

- Adaptive Tone on/off

- Mic Control on/off

- Footswitch on/off

Design

Mic In to Out

Input Connector: XLR female, balanced

Input Impedance: 3k1 Ohm

Input Clip Sensitivity: -1 dBu

SNR A-Weighted: > 114 dB

Phantom Power: 24V (always on)

Output Connector: XLR male, impedance balanced, pin 2 hot

Output impedance: 200 Ohm

Output Full Scale Level: +7.5 dBu

Input to Output Frequency Response: +0/-0.3 dB, 20 Hz to 20 kHz

Guitar In to Guitar Thru

Input Impedance: 1 MOhm

Guitar Input Level @ 0 dBFS: -7 dBU to 17 dBu

Dynamic Range: > 117 dB, 20 Hz to 20 kHz

Physical

- Height: 5.4 inches (140 mm)

- Width: 3.5 inches (90 mm)

- Depth: 2.3 inches (60 mm)

- Weight: 0.92 lb. (0.42 kg)

- Two-part die cast metal

- Rubber adhesive feet

Power

Power Supply (Not Included): 9V 670mA

Power Consumption: 6W
